Метод 1: Коришћење Апт пакета
Метод 2: Ручна конфигурација
овнЦлоуд је услуга слична Дропбок-у која ради на вашем сопственом ВПС-у. Даје вам потпуну контролу над простором, корисницима и разним другим функцијама.
Овај водич претпоставља да имате потпуно нови Дебиан 7 ВПС од Вултр-а и да сте пријављени као роот. Ако нисте пријављени као роот, откуцајте:
su -
... затим унесите своју роот лозинку. Сада ћете бити пријављени као роот корисник.
Постоје два начина да инсталирате овнЦлоуд. Први начин ће користити њихов апт пакет и аутоматски ће се сам инсталирати. Други користи ручну инсталацију, што вам даје већу флексибилност, као и спољни унос веб сервера као што је Нгинк или Апацхе. Користићемо Апацхе са упутствима за руковање.
Метод 1: Коришћење Апт пакета
Ово је лакше решење.
Додајте спремиште на своју листу извора
Почнимо додавањем спремишта које укључује овнЦлоуд на вашу листу извора. Ово се лако може урадити коришћењем ове команде:
echo 'deb http://download.opensuse.org/repositories/isv:/ownCloud:/community/Debian_7.0/ /' >> /etc/apt/sources.list.d/owncloud.list
Када то урадите, једноставно извршите одговарајуће ажурирање да бисте били сигурни да су сви пакети доступни и спремни:
apt-get update
Инсталирајте овнЦлоуд
Инсталирајте овнЦлоуд преко апт са овом командом:
apt-get install ownCloud
Упозориће вас у вези са верификацијом пакета - само укуцајте "и" да бисте наставили. Ово је мера предострожности коју је урадио Дебиан како би осигурао да сте потпуно свесни шта инсталирате и одакле се инсталира (што смо ми).
И то је то! Готови сте. Наставите са подешавањем овнЦлоуд-а тако што ћете ићи на https://yourdomain.com/owncloudу свом претраживачу и пратити кораке подешавања.
Метод 2: Ручна конфигурација
Ово је теже решење.
Ако имате постојећи ВПС који већ има веб сервер на себи, пратите овај метод за мало већу флексибилност на том путу.
Инсталирајте зависности
Прво, морамо да инсталирамо зависности које су потребне за овнЦлоуд да би функционисале.
apt-get install apache2 libapache2-mod-php5 php5-gd php5-common php5-sqlite php5-curl php5-intl php5-mcrypt php5-imagick
Преузмите овнЦлоуд
wget https://download.owncloud.org/community/owncloud-7.0.3.tar.bz2
Распакујте и померите
Распакујте овнЦлоуд архиву:
tar -xjf owncloud-7.0.3.tar.bz2
Избришите преосталу тар датотеку:
rm owncloud-7.0.3.tar.bz2
Преместите извучену фасциклу у свој веб директоријум, који се подразумевано налази на /var/www:
mv owncloud /var/www/
Конфигуришите Апацхе
Мораћете да свом apacheкориснику дате потпуни приступ том директоријуму:
chown -R www-data:www-data /var/www/
Направите неке измене у нашој Апацхе конфигурационој датотеци:
nano /etc/apache2/sites-enabled/000-default
Промените овај блок:
<Directory /var/www/>
Options Indexes FollowSymLinks MultiViews
AllowOverride none
Order allow,deny
allow from all
</Directory>
... на следеће:
<Directory /var/www/>
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all
</Directory>
Сачувајте датотеку тако што ћете откуцати ЦТРЛ + Кс , затим И , а затим ЕНТЕР .
Наш последњи корак је да омогућимо Апацхе мод, а затим поново покренемо Апацхе:
a2enmod rewrite
service apache2 restart
И спремни сте! Наставите са подешавањем овнЦлоуд-а тако што ћете ићи на https://yourdomain.com/owncloudу свом претраживачу и пратити кораке подешавања.